dalandan
Tagalog edit
Etymology edit
From a corruption of Spanish naranjal (“orange grove”).
Pronunciation edit
Noun edit
dalandán (Baybayin spelling ᜇᜎᜈ᜔ᜇᜈ᜔)
- bitter orange (Citrus aurantium)
- generic term for some local varieties of oranges such as dalanghita and sintunis
- orange (color)
